Introduction
At this point of the course, one should have a solid grasp of static evasion using encryption (XOR/RC4/AES) and obfuscation (IPv4/IPv6/MAC/UUID) techniques. Implementing one or more of the previously discussed evasion techniques in the malware can be time-consuming. One solution is to build a tool that takes in the payload and performs the encryption or obfuscation methods.
This module will demo a tool made by the Maldev Academy team that performs these tasks.
Tool Features
The tool has the following features:
- Supports IPv4/IPv6/MAC/UUID Obfuscation
- Supports XOR/RC4/AES encryption
- Supports payload padding
- Provides the decryption function for the selected encryption/obfuscation technique
- Randomly generated encryption keys on every run
Usage
To use HellShell, download the source code and compile it manually. Ensure the build option is set to Release.
###########################################################
# HellShell - Designed By MalDevAcademy @NUL0x4C | @mrd0x #
###########################################################
[!] Usage: HellShell.exe <Input Payload FileName> <Enc/Obf *Option*>
[i] Options Can Be :
1.>>> "mac" ::: Output The Shellcode As A Array Of Mac Addresses [FC-48-83-E4-F0-E8]
2.>>> "ipv4" ::: Output The Shellcode As A Array Of Ipv4 Addresses [252.72.131.228]
3.>>> "ipv6" ::: Output The Shellcode As A Array Of Ipv6 Addresses [FC48:83E4:F0E8:C000:0000:4151:4150:5251]
4.>>> "uuid" ::: Output The Shellcode As A Array Of UUid Strings [FC4883E4-F0E8-C000-0000-415141505251]
5.>>> "aes" ::: Output The Shellcode As A Array Of Aes Encrypted Shellcode With Random Key And Iv
6.>>> "rc4" ::: Output The Shellcode As A Array Of Rc4 Encrypted Shellcode With Random Key
Example Commands
HellShell.exe calc.bin aes
- Generates an AES encrypted payload and prints it to the console
HellShell.exe calc.bin aes > AesPayload.c
- Generates an AES-encrypted payload and outputs it toAesPayload.c
HellShell.exe calc.bin ipv6
- Generates an IPv6 obfuscated payload and prints it to the console
